Systemair strengthen its presence in the U.S.

Systemair has on May 13 2008 acquired the assets of Emerson Ventilation from the American company Emerson Climate Technologies, the company is based in Kansas City and has been manufacturing fans since the 1890's.

The operation comprises the manufacture of fans and ventilation materials with a turnover of approx. 10 million US dollars.

The operations will be integrated with Systemair´s present activities in North America, which are carried out under the name Fantech and are presently concentrated mainly on the housing sector.

  • With this acquisition we have a base for our continued concentration on the building up our commercial product range within North America and we see this move as giving us greater scope to increase our presence in the market, says Gerald Engström, CEO of Systemair.

Systemair in brief

Systemair is a leading ventilation company, with activities in 38 countries in Europe, North America, Asia, the Middle East, South Africa, and Australia. The Company had sales of just over SEK 2.7 billion in the preceding financial year and approximately 1,850 employees. Since its foundation in 1974, Systemair has steadily increased its annual sales while simultaneously returning positive operating profits. Over the past decade, the company has averaged 16 percent annual growth in sales. The Group comprises around 50 companies.

Systemair has well-established operations in a number of growth markets – notably those of Central and Eastern Europe, including Russia. The Group's products are marketed under the brands Systemair, Frico, VEAB and Fantech. Systemair shares have been traded on the Mid Cap List of the OMX Nordic Exchange in Stockholm since 12 October 2007.
